
Paul Pogba is set to miss the first three months in his Juventus return due to an injury.
The French international midfielder may end-up waiting for two to three months before making his second debut for Juventus because of a knee injury.
The 29-year-old made his return to Turin this summer on a free transfer having spent six years with Manchester United.
Pogba has featured just once in Juventus’ pre-season tour, playing against Chivas in the United States but the Old Lady has ruled him out for three months.
The world cup winner missed a big part of Manchester United campaign last season due to injuries and it is a huge blow for the Italian side that are rebuilding their squad to bring back the Serie A title next season.
